Utilizing hair testing has become increasingly recognized as an effective method for identifying drug and alcohol consumption. Hair captures a prolonged history of substance use by embedding biomarkers within the fibers of a developing hair strand. When collected near the scalp, hair can provide a detection period of up to approximately three months for alcohol and other substances. The collection process is straightforward, challenging to tamper with, and easily transportable.
A sample consisting of 1.5 inches of about 200 strands of hair (roughly the circumference of a #2 pencil) taken nearest to the scalp yields 100mg of hair, which represents the optimal quantity for both screening and verification. For EtG, add-ons, and tests exceeding 10 panels, a collection of 150mg is advisable. It is suggested to weigh the hair using a jeweler’s scale. Should scalp hair not be available, an equivalent quantity of body hair can be gathered. References to head hair pertain specifically to scalp hair, while body hair encompasses all other hair types (facial, axillary, etc.).
Process Overview
The laboratory processing of a drug test involves four key stages: Accessioning, Screening, Extraction, and Confirmation.
During Accessioning, a sample undergoes initial processing into the lab's system. This step includes checking that the sample was securely sealed and correctly shipped, allocating a random LAN (Laboratory Accessioning Number), and performing any extra data entry not handled by an electronic chain of custody system.
Screening serves as a preliminary rapid test for detecting drugs of abuse. Although Screening provides a cost-effective method for excluding drug usage in most samples, a positive screening result must be confirmed for legal admissibility. Any samples with presumptively positive results in Screening are subjected to additional confirmation.
In instances of presumptive positives during Screening, more hair is retrieved from the original specimen and readied for Extraction. At this stage, substances are extracted from hair at a notably lower concentration than seen in other methods (e.g., urine or oral fluid), making hair drug testing the most challenging methodology.
Confirmation of any positive Screen results utilizes GC/MS, GC/MS/MS, or LC/MS/MS technologies. All presumptive positive samples undergo necessary cleansing before confirmation. The end-to-end laboratory process, from Accessioning to Confirmation, is evaluated under both the CAP (College of American Pathologists) Hair credential and accreditation to ISO / IEC 17025 standards.

Note: Commonly termed as "hair follicle tests," this testing actually examines the hair strand rather than the follicle beneath the scalp.

The joint meeting of the Society of Hair Testing (SoHT) and the Italian Group of Forensic Toxicologists (GTFI) was organized in Verona, June 8–10, 2022, and hosted by the Legal Medicine team of the Verona University Hospital, directed by Franco Tagliaro together with Federica Bortolotti and Rossella Gottardo.
It served as a prominent platform for knowledge exchange and collaboration, facilitating groundbreaking advancements in hair testing and analysis. In this special issue of Drug Testing and Analysis, we aim to showcase the remarkable manuscripts presented at this significant event, shedding light on the latest research and highlighting the future directions in this field.
Novel Analytical Techniques: The Verona meeting witnessed the unveiling of cutting-edge analytical techniques, offering enhanced sensitivity, selectivity, and accuracy for drug testing. Remarkable advancements in sample preparation, detection, and identification of drug compounds have been presented. The manuscripts in this section presented novel approaches, such as multianalyte methods and on-line preparation which can enable rapid analysis and improve thorough forensic investigations.
Biomarkers and Pharmacokinetics: The identification and validation of reliable biomarkers and pharmacokinetic studies are fundamental aspects of drug testing and analysis. The impact of hair treatments on the oxidation/decomposition of drugs in hair was also explored, as the long-term fate of drugs incorporated in the keratin matrix. Furthermore, the SoHT meeting in Verona featured research on the identification and quantification of alcohol abuse biomarkers, their stability, and their correlation with exposure and other biomarkers.
Forensic Applications and Interpretation: One of the vital objectives of hair testing is its application in forensic investigations and legal proceedings. The SoHT meeting in Verona emphasized the significance of rigorous interpretation of analytical results and the need for standardized protocols. Manuscripts in this section present advancements in forensic toxicology, and have explored the challenges posed by emerging designer drugs and strategies to combat their proliferation. The pitfalls encountered when the exogenous/endogenous nature of a substance is questioned were presented and discussed. The special issue presents also manuscripts that delve into the ethical implications of drug testing in drug facilitated sexual assaults.
Clinical Applications of hair testing are witnessed by the insight on environmental tobacco smoke exposure, assessed by hair analysis in a population of students and the study of in utero-exposure to drugs of abuse through neonatal hair analysis. Exposure to drugs was also important in cases of child abuse/neglect, when the clinical purpose of hair testing merge with its forensic applications.
The legal framework surrounding hair testing and the achievement of guidelines to ensure fairness, accuracy, and confidentiality in drug testing practices have also been discussed,and the SoHT consensus on general hair testing and testing for drugs of abuse was presented at the meeting and published as a Letter to the Editor.
